#a76169 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a76169 is composed of 65.5% red, 38%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 41.9% magenta, 37.1% yellow and 34.5% black. It has a hue angle of 353.1 degrees, a saturation of 28.5% and a lightness of 51.8%. #a76169 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c2d2 with #4f0000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

Shades and Tints of #a76169

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060304 is the darkest color, while #fbf8f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a76169

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b7d7f is the less saturated color, while #fc0c27 is the most saturated one.
